... Read moreFrom personal experience, chasing your dream life often feels like an uphill battle. You know what you want, but life throws constant challenges that drain your energy and motivation. I’ve found that it’s normal to feel tired and exhausted sometimes, but the key is to intentionally create space and schedule time for what truly matters. This means prioritizing your goals over distractions and aiming for smarter, not harder, work. One important lesson I learned is to stop living in survivor mode—where you’re just getting by without real progress. Instead, embracing intentional living allows you to be clear about your desires and take proactive steps. For example, breaking your big goals into small daily actions makes it easier to stay consistent and maintain motivation. It’s okay to feel tired but keep trying; progress is rarely linear. Sharing your journey with others who relate can provide support and accountability. Reflecting on what you want and why it matters helps sustain energy levels, especially when the going gets tough. Remember, it’s about building your dream life step by step with patience and intentionality. Celebrate small wins and adjust your schedule thoughtfully to avoid burnout. Life may keep happening, but your commitment to growth, coupled with strategic planning, will bring you closer to the life you envision.
